Reduce anti-social behaviour and associated criminality in Fieldings Road
Issued 10 May 2025
During June 2025 the Cheshunt East Neighbourhood Policing Team have continued to work with partner agencies such as Broxbourne Council, Broxbourne Parks Patrol and the Driver & Vehicle Standards Agency to tackle this issue. On 23 June 2025, an Action Day took place where a number of penalty charge notices were issued to vehicles that were contravening parking restrictions.
In addition, regular patrols continue to take place and further Action Days are planned.

Target acquisitive crime in and around the location of Waltham Cross town centre.
Issued 10 May 2025
Extra police patrols have continued to take place during June 2025 as part of Operation Hotspot, a £1 million countywide operation to target those intent in committing anti-social behaviour or criminality in the area. This is to ensure members of public can continue to work, visit and enjoy the various events happening in the town centre over the summer months
